1. Essential EU Regulatory Frameworks for Battery Manufacturers

To legally display the CE (Conformité Européenne) mark, a custom lithium battery pack assembly must demonstrate full compliance across several overlapping European Directives and safety standards. OEM buyers must verify that their factory partner provides complete Technical Dossiers covering the following directives:

  • Low Voltage Directive (LVD) 2014/35/EU & IEC/EN 62133-2:2017: The primary safety benchmark for secondary lithium cells and battery packs containing alkaline or non-acid electrolytes used in portable applications. EN 62133-2 mandates rigorous testing against mechanical shock, vibration, external short-circuiting, thermal abuse, overcharging, and forced internal short circuits.
  •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C) Directive 2014/30/EU: For battery packs equipped with integrated digital Battery Management Systems (BMS), smart state-of-charge (SoC) microcontrollers, or active balancing circuitry, the system must not emit disruptive electromagnetic interference (EMI) nor fail when subjected to external electrostatic discharges (ESD).
  • Radio Equipment Directive (RED) 2014/53/EU: Applies to smart battery packs featuring embedded wireless telemetries, such as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E), Wi-Fi, or CAN-bus wireless status transmitters used in medical, automotive, or AI wearable applications.
  • RoHS Directive 2011/65/EU & (EU) 2015/863: Restricts the presence of ten hazardous substances, including lead, mercury, cadmium, hexavalent chromium, and specific phthalates (DEHP, BBP, DBP, DIBP), guaranteeing environmentally sound end-of-life processing.
  • REACH Regulation (EC) No 1907/2006: Ensures strict monitoring of Substances of Very High Concern (SVHC) throughout the chemical supply chain, confirming zero hazardous chemical off-gassing or leakage.

Future Procurement Trends in Battery Manufacturing

Key technological shifts shaping enterprise sourcing strategies for custom battery packs over the next decade.

1. Migration to High Silicon-Anode & Solid-State Chemistries

Global procurement teams are shifting away from conventional graphite-anode Li-ion cells toward high-silicon composite anodes and semi-solid-state electrolytes. Delivering energy densities up to 380 Wh/kg, these cell technologies allow smart wearables, micro-electronics, and handheld instruments to operate 40% longer without increasing structural volume.

2. Digital Battery Passports & Carbon Traceability

Under the EU Battery Regulation (EU 2023/1542), future procurement contracts mandate fully traceable battery lifecycle metrics. Advanced factories now embed serialised digital passports accessible via encrypted QR codes, disclosing raw material origins, recycled material percentages, and lifecycle carbon intensity.

3. Smart AI-Driven BMS Integration

Modern CE-certified battery packs are transitioning from passive protection PCBs to intelligent, micro-BMS architectures equipped with edge-AI algorithms. These chips predict cell degradation, dynamically optimize active balancing, and transmit real-time telemetry via SMBus, I2C, or CAN protocols to avoid unscheduled equipment downtime.

Key Engineering Innovations Driving Custom Battery Pack Performance

From ultra-micro form factors to thermal isolation: how custom battery factories solve complex physical constraints.

As consumer hardware, medical diagnostics, AI wearables, and industrial IoT devices undergo dramatic miniaturization, the demands placed on original battery pack manufacturers have evolved. Sourcing off-the-shelf cylindrical cells is no longer viable for compact electronics that require specialized geometry, high discharge rates, and rigorous thermal safety.

Micro-Miniaturization & Curved Form Factor Engineering

In applications such as smart AI eyewear, AR headsets, and digital health rings (as featured in our product range), battery architecture must conform to ergonomic spatial constraints. Factory innovations in Polymer Lithium Cobalt Oxide (LiCoO2) pouch cells allow ultra-thin profiles down to 0.8mm and custom curved radii without sacrificing energy density or structural stability. Micro-welding via automated cold-laser pulse techniques ensures zero thermal degradation to sensitive protection circuits during assembly.

Multi-Layered Mechanical & Electrical Protection Architectures

True safety excellence requires defense-in-depth engineering within every single pack. Premium OEM manufacturing protocols integrate multi-stage protection mechanisms:

  • Cell-Level Defense: Positive Temperature Coefficient (PTC) thermistors, Safety Vents, and Ceramic-Coated Microporous Separators that prevent internal dendritic shorting under high thermal loads.
  • PCM/BMS-Level Defense: Dual-redundant Integrated Circuits (ICs) monitoring individual cell voltage, continuous load current, and ambient temperature via NTC thermistors.
  • Structural Encapsulation: High-impact, flame-retardant polycarbonate housing (UL94-V0 rated) combined with low-pressure silicone injection molding for IP67/IP68 ingress protection against water, sweat, and salt spray.

Fast-Charging Protocols & Thermal Dissipation Pathways

Modern enterprise users demand rapid turnaround cycles. Incorporating Gallium Nitride (GaN) fast-charging interfaces alongside high-C-rate cell formulations allows 0-to-80% charging in under 30 minutes. To handle the associated thermal stress, engineers integrate phase-change material (PCM) graphite heat spreaders that quickly transfer heat away from the cell core, preserving cell longevity over 800+ full charge-discharge cycles.

What specific documentation is required to verify a battery manufacturer's CE certification?
A valid CE mark on a lithium battery pack must be supported by an official EU Declaration of Conformity (DoC) issued by the manufacturer, alongside comprehensive Test Reports from an accredited ISO/IEC 17025 laboratory. These reports must verify compliance with the Low Voltage Directive (IEC/EN 62133-2 for safety), EMC Directive (EN 61000-6-1/3 for electronics), and RoHS Directive (EN IEC 63000 for hazardous materials). Beware of suppliers offering self-declaration letters without supporting IEC test reports.
How does your factory ensure cell consistency across high-volume custom battery pack runs?
Cell consistency is critical to preventing premature pack degradation, cell imbalance, and thermal runaway. Our factory employs automated 4-point sorting machines that test 100% of incoming cells for Open Circuit Voltage (OCV) and AC Internal Resistance (AC-IR). Cells are sorted into tight tolerance groups (voltage delta ≤ 5mV, internal resistance delta ≤ 1.5mΩ) before entering spot-welding and BMS integration.

What safety features are integrated into your custom Smart BMS architectures?
Our custom Protection Circuit Modules (PCM) and Smart BMS boards feature multi-tiered hardware and software safeguards: Over-charge voltage protection (OVP), Over-discharge voltage cutoff (UVP), Over-current charge/discharge protection (OCP), External short-circuit detection with dynamic auto-recovery, integrated NTC thermistors for continuous thermal monitoring, and cell-balancing networks to equalize capacity during charge cycles.
How do you handle shipping compliance and dangerous goods (DG) logistics for lithium batteries?
Lithium batteries are classified as Class 9 Dangerous Goods under international transport regulations. Our factory provides full UN 38.3 test summaries, Material Safety Data Sheets (MSDS), and UN-approved hazardous packaging (PI965/PI966/PI967 compliant boxes). We work directly with certified DG freight forwarders to ensure seamless sea, air, and express logistics clearance into Europe, North America, and global markets.
